Compliant Filed: ohzeeg.livejournal.com
August 12, 2010 by admin
Filed under Complaint Blogshops, Scam and Complaint BlogShops
This was posted by BlinkPlane on SgClub Forum.
She saw this unique, amazing jacket for sale on a site called ohzeeg.livejournal.com. I’m sure by now you’ve realized that the link and the info have all been shifted. And that’s not even the end of the problem for BlinkPlane.
She paid for the said jacket last March 5, 2010. Basically, it’s been ages since she made that payment. After a long time, it turns out that there’s still no jacket in sight even if the site specifically indicated that the merchandise will arrive after 2-3 weeks. Or was the TERMS AND CONDITIONS page severely in need of revisions? Take note, the item was on sale for a total of 49.90 Singaporean Dollars folks! BlinkPlane could have spent the money elsewhere.
She kept on bugging the management about the paid merchandise regularly to no avail. And just when it’s too late, they email her three (yes, THREE!) whole months later only to inform her that the jacket she ordered is actually out of stock. They must have a really big warehouse. Or they may have missed a lot of stock inventory. What do you think? There may be a host of reasons why they made the mistake.
In my opinion, they totally neglected the order sent by BlinkPlane even if the payment was already made. Now if that isn’t irresponsible, then I don’t know what is!
To make matter worse, they promised to send a refund back but she hasn’t received any at all. Adding insult to injury is the fact that the link has been shifted and she has no way to contact them anymore.
Just in case the same scenario happens to you, make sure you contact your bank or credit card issuer to freeze any transactions done. You may even get a new credit account number to make sure scammers can’t access your cash! Be careful folks, the next story might be all about your own online experience!

Clueless about Scams…?
July 20, 2010 by admin
Filed under Scam and Complaint BlogShops
Are you clueless about internet scams and other tricks online? Well, a very smart blogger used a forum to ask some much-needed advice, and she ended learning a great deal about the site she was particularly interested about.
Here’s the whole story. Andylsbc6 found a bunch of great deals on “apple” merchandise in a company called Mobile World Ltd under the link www.88db.com.sg. The site is a non-local one from the United Kingdom. The products they sold were extremely cheap. It was just too good to be true! No wonder our blogger was interested and wary at the same time.
Thankfully, some bloggers did their own little research and they found these awful details. In the site’s registration details, Dotti, a fellow blogger found that the site was created only last March 9, 2010. That means the site has been existing for just a few months. However, if you browse through the link about them, you will notice that they claim to have been around for nearly two years!
In addition, the contact person on the site was a certain Sam Wales. After a quick background check, Dotti also found out that he is involve in illegal business online. He offers fake address details, phone numbers and credit card digits to Nigerians in the U.S. In his site are a couple of fraudulent testimonials which are exact copycats of various other testimonials from different sites too! Isn’t that pretty scary or what?
And one last thing, credible companies don’t just use Western Union unless they’re up to something fishy. Besides, what kind of business has no existing bank account? That would seem pretty weird, right? If you have to pay through Western Union, it means you will simply be handing out money to a complete stranger! So if that’s part of their payment options, you’d better click it off and find something else!
It’s nice to know we can help each other when it comes to uncovering scams online. And by sharing all these very important information, we help save online customers from shopping nightmares that are simply waiting to happen!
